About NATIONAL HEALTH INVESTORS INC
National Health Investors, Inc. is a self-managed real estate investment trust specializing in sale-leaseback, joint venture, mortgage and mezzanine financing of need-driven and discretionary senior housing and medical facility investments. NHI's portfolio consists of independent living facilities, assisted living and memory care communities, entrance-fee retirement communities, senior living campuses, skilled nursing facilities and specialty hospitals. National Health Investors, Inc. was established on October 15th 1991 and was incorporated in 1991 in Maryland and is based in Murfreesboro, Tennessee.

Does NHI pay a dividend, and is it safe?
Yes. NATIONAL HEALTH INVESTORS INC pays a dividend yielding about 4.51% with a 119.4% payout ratio, rated “at-risk” for safety.
How profitable is NHI?
In FY2025, NATIONAL HEALTH INVESTORS INC had a net margin of 37.9% and a return on equity of 9.3%.
Is NHI overvalued or undervalued?
NATIONAL HEALTH INVESTORS INC trades at about 23.4× trailing earnings — near its 10-year norm (10-year range 15.7×–39.8×, median 22.7×). Stocktoria reports the data, not buy/sell advice.
